Дата:2011-04-20
Webdav - защищенный сетевой протокол который работает через HTTP. Может использоваться для совершения операций на сервере по общему обмену, редактированию, загрузке, выгрузке файлов с клиентской станции на удаленный сервер.
<>Устанавливаем Apache
yum install httpd
Редактируем конфигурационный файл
vi /etc/httpd/conf/httpd.conf
и снимаем комментарии с
LoadModule dav_module modules/mod_dav.so
LoadModule dav_fs_module modules/mod_dav_fs.so
Создаем пользователя user1
htpasswd /var/www/web1/users.dav user1
Для последующего добавления
пользователей используем ключ -с "htpasswd -c
/var/www/web1/users.dav user2"
Добавляем в файл httpd.conf
vi /etc/httpd/conf/httpd.conf
[...]
NameVirtualHost *:80
<VirtualHost *:80>
ServerAdmin
webmaster@localhost
DocumentRoot /var/www/webdav
<Directory
/var/www/webdav/>
Options Indexes MultiViews
AllowOverride None
Order allow,deny
allow from all
</Directory>
Alias /webdav /var/www/webdav
<Location /webdav>
DAV On
AuthType
Basic
AuthName
"webdav"
AuthUserFile /var/www/webdav/users.dav
Require
valid-user
</Location>
</VirtualHost>
Перестартуем Apache
/etc/init.d/apache2 reload
Настройка Windows на использование
WebDav
Сетевое окружение -- Добавить новый элемент в сетевое окружение
-- Далее -- Щелкнем 2 раза на Вкладке: выберите новое сетевое окружение
и введем IP адрес нашего webdav http://192.168.XX.XX:80/webdav
Количество просмотров: 10327
Комментарии к статье:
Всё работает! только не пойму - какой пасс вводить?
В файле AuthUserFile /var/www/webdav/users.dav заводятся пользователи. А для добавления пользователей используется: htpasswd -c /var/www/web1/users.dav имя_пользователя пароль
Добавить комментарий
Автор комментария: webkot
Дата: 2011-07-28
Архив нельзя сделать по-компактней,Раза 4 гугль меня сюда приводил, думал дорвей с "дисплей блок", оказалось всё в подвале прячется! Статью не читал ещё, позже отпишусь.